Execution, filing, and recording of statements

(a) A statement delivered to the Mayor for filing by a partnership shall be executed by at least 2 partners. Other statements shall be executed by a partner or other person authorized by this chapter.

(b) A person that delivers a statement to the Mayor for filing pursuant to this section shall promptly send a copy of the statement to every nonfiling partner and to any other person named as a partner in the statement. Failure to send a copy of a statement to a partner or other person shall not limit the effectiveness of the statement as to a person not a partner.

(c) A statement delivered to the Mayor for filing by a partnership shall be executed by at least 2 partners. Other statements shall be executed by a partner or other person authorized by this chapter An individual who executes a statement shall personally declare under penalty of making false statements that the contents of the statement are accurate.

(d) A person authorized by this chapter to deliver a statement to the Mayor for filing may amend or cancel the statement by delivering filing an amendment or cancellation to the Mayor for filing that names the partnership, identifies the statement, and states the substance of the amendment or cancellation.

(e) A person that delivers a statement to the Mayor for filing pursuant to this section shall promptly send a copy of the statement to every nonfiling partner and to any other person named as a partner in the statement. Failure to send a copy of a statement to a partner or other person shall not limit the effectiveness of the statement as to a person not a partner.

(July 2, 2011, D.C. Law 18-378, § 2, 58 DCR 1720; Mar. 5, 2013, D.C. Law 19-210, § 2(f)(2)(D), 59 DCR 13171.)

Effect of Amendments

The 2013 amendment by D.C. Law 19-210 substituted “making false statements” for “perjury” in (c).

Editor's Notes

Uniform Law: This section is based on § 105 of the Uniform Partnership Act (1997 Act).

Application of Law 19-210: Section 7 of D.C. Law 19-210 provided that the act shall apply as of January 1, 2012.
